Candy cane - Wikipedia
A striped candy cane being made by hand from a large mass of red-and-white sugar syrup. As with other forms of stick candy, the earliest canes were manufactured by hand. Chicago confectioners the Bunte Brothers filed one of the earliest patents for candy cane making machines in the early 1920s. [13] See more
A candy cane is a cane-shaped stick candy often associated with Christmastide as well as Saint Nicholas Day. It is traditionally white with red stripes and flavored with peppermint, … See more
A record of the 1837 exhibition of the Massachusetts Charitable Mechanic Association, where confections were judged competitively, mentions "stick candy". A recipe for straight peppermint candy sticks, … See more
On Saint Nicholas Day celebrations, candy canes are given to children as they are also said to represent the crosier of the Christian bishop Saint Nicholas; crosiers allude to the Good Shepherd, a name sometimes used to refer to Jesus of Nazareth. See more
